STATE THEATRE

“TANKS A MILLION.” Headed by a cast of comedy luminaries including Jimmy Gleason, William Tracy, Noah Beery Junr, and Elyse Knox, the new Hal Roach streamliner, “Tanks a Million,” the laugh-filled story of Uncle Sam's draft army, will be shown tonight at the State Theate. The location site for “Tanks a Million” was Northbridge, California, where a working replica of a complete service encampment was established. Authentic in every detail, although of necessity telescoped in size, the camp was the produce of the Hal Roach studio technicians’ ingenuity. Through a huge wooden archway, past the receiving station, there were barracks, parade grounds,' mess hall and row upon row of tents —all reconstructed with utmost fidelity. “Tanks a Million” is one of the outstanding comedies of the year, and should not be missed by those who enjoy a good laugh in these strenuous times. Another excellent comedy, “Miss Polly,” featuring Slim Summerville and Zasu Pitts, will also be shown.
